Section 01

Neighborhood Overview

Groveport Recreation is situated in the growing community of Groveport, a suburb southeast of Columbus, Ohio. Its location offers a balance between accessible amenities and a slightly less congested environment than the downtown core. The primary access route is Groveport Road, which connects to Alum Creek Drive and subsequently to major highways like I-70 and US-33, facilitating travel to and from the venue. Parking is generally ample directly at the recreation center, with designated areas for event parking during peak times. The nearest major airport is John Glenn Columbus International Airport (CMH), which is about a 15-20 minute drive away via I-70 East. For those utilizing rideshares or taxis, pinpointing the recreation center's main entrance or designated drop-off zone is recommended to avoid confusion with event parking. Smart arrival tactics often involve checking local traffic reports, especially during peak hours or large event days, to navigate potential delays on feeder roads.

Section 02

Where to Stay

The immediate area around Groveport Recreation is developing, with a mix of residential neighborhoods and emerging commercial areas. While there isn't a dense cluster of hotels directly adjacent to the facility, several lodging options are available within a 10-15 minute drive in nearby communities such as Canal Winchester, Reynoldsburg, or the Rickenbacker International Airport area. Many teams and families opt for accommodations in these surrounding towns, which offer a wider range of hotel brands and price points. For those seeking proximity, properties closer to the Rickenbacker area or along the main arteries leading to Groveport might be convenient. Demand for lodging typically spikes around major tournaments or community events hosted at the recreation center, so booking well in advance is highly recommended. Utilizing hotel booking filters that show proximity to specific addresses or ZIP codes can help narrow down choices, and checking recent reviews can offer insight into family-friendliness and suitability for sports groups.

5–15 Minutes Away

Blacklick Woods Golf Course

2.4 mi

For golf enthusiasts, Blacklick Woods offers a public 18-hole course providing a pleasant round of golf amidst natural surroundings. The course is known for its mature trees and varied terrain, presenting a fair challenge for players of all skill levels. It's a great option for adult groups looking for a foursome activity or for anyone wanting to enjoy a scenic outdoor experience near Groveport.

Blacklick Creek Nature Preserve

3.5 mi

This nature preserve offers a network of trails through diverse habitats, including forests, meadows, and wetlands. It's an excellent spot for a peaceful walk, birdwatching, or simply enjoying the local flora and fauna. The trails are generally well-maintained, providing an accessible outdoor escape for individuals or families seeking a break from athletic events.

Section 08

Weather & Seasons

❄️

Winter

Expect cold temperatures, with highs often in the 30s and lows dropping below freezing. Layers are essential, including thermal base layers, sweaters, and insulated outerwear. Hats, gloves, and scarves are highly recommended for outdoor activities. Indoor facilities remain comfortable, but travel to and from the venue may require careful attention to icy conditions on roads and sidewalks.

🌱

Spring & early summer

Temperatures begin to warm, ranging from the 50s in early spring to the 70s and 80s by late May and June. Comfortable, breathable clothing is suitable for athletes. Light jackets or hoodies are useful for cooler mornings and evenings. Rain showers are common, so packing a light raincoat or umbrella is advisable for outdoor spectators.

☀️

Mid-summer

Expect warm to hot and humid conditions, with daily highs frequently in the upper 80s and 90s. Staying hydrated is critical for athletes and spectators. Lightweight, moisture-wicking clothing is recommended. S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ses are essential for prolonged outdoor exposure. Seek shade whenever possible during breaks.

🍂

Fall season

Temperatures become cooler and more crisp, generally ranging from the 50s to 70s through September and October. This season offers very pleasant conditions for outdoor sports. Layers remain a good strategy, with a light jacket or sweater often sufficient. The risk of rain persists, but snowfall is unlikely until late November or December.

📅

Rain & snow

Rain can occur year-round, often bringing cooler temperatures regardless of the season. During wet conditions, expect muddy fields and potentially slippery surfaces, requiring appropriate footwear. Snowfall is typically limited to winter months, but even light accumulation can make driving and walking hazardous. Always check local weather advisories and venue updates for potential delays or cancellations due to severe weather.
